This is another Holly Black novel, which means its all about the Fairfolk. Hazel and her brother Ben grow up in a town right beside the Fairfolk and spend a lot of time in the forest where they are. In the forest, there is a boy in a glass coffin that Hazel and Ben are obsessed with. He's been sleeping forever, until one day he wasn't.

Hazel obviously wanted to be a knight, and kiss boys. As the story goes on she wants to remember the years she spent as a night. Ben just wants to play music. There friendship was really well done and I like how much they supported each other.

I enjoyed this book. I thought it was a fun read and was a dark and creepy fairytale. It's a good one if you don't think too hard about it. The writing was good and atmospheric but the story felt shallow to me. Hazel and Ben weren't developed enough and the love interests even less.

It's a book thats the perfect example of okay. There are things that are drawbacks for it but it's still weirdly enjoyable. It's a fun, quick read for the summer.

3/5
I'd recommend this to fairy fans and fans of Holly Black. If you like her other works, you'll probably enjoy these. It's also one of the better fairy novels that I've read. It's very much a "younger" YA, so I'd recommend it to people who are a little younger.

I loved the Coldest Girl In Cold Town so I decided to read some more books by Holly Black and I was not disappointed. For being a stand alone as well as a fantasy book she did a wonderful job at setting up the world and characters completely. I was drawn into this world the moment I started reading. I love how she made it seem like the basic cliches were going to take place but then she flipped everything on us. I also loved how she didn't make the brother and sister relationship perfect; they had many flaws. Holly Black is definitely now on my radar.
